this car is from dona ana county las cruces new mexico DSO 56-0015
the car is all stock with 55,000 miles according to the clean carfax and auto check and the tags on all in place,no wrecks,2 buck tags has no angency listed just says police DSO 2 times on one tag and the other tag has all the other info and says under the DSO tag that the car is property of new mexico traffic bueral and has a little sticker on oppsite side of the door jam that says property of dona anna county,I found the built sheet under the rear seat still in good shape it says jan 1st 1992 dona anna county and all the info and says ssp on the bottom with a few of the ssp parts ordered like hoses,also the car has no rust anywhere very clean the driver seat has lots of wear needs to be replaced,few panels need to be put back on needs a passenger sunviser and 2 door handles and driver side door pins,power locks work good,fuel gauge and temp.not working,lots of holes on the dash and there is some kinda police equipment under the hood still with all the wires,lots of goodies still on the car and I have to say no one has taken off anything still has oil cooler,130 amp alt,160 speedo,trans cooler(trans works great)stock cats,stock catback,air horn,wires,dose not have blue hoses but where ordered on built sheet,I'll get some pic's soon,and I'm very happy with her (I will need a one spotlight it still has the mounting bracket on the post) so what do I consider this ssp a NM ssp cause they were made in 1990 only from what the usage chart says and no 1992's????

1st - welcome to the forum!

Since the state of NM didn't buy SSP's in 92 according to known records, and the fact that you found the sticker that says property of dona anna county, I'd be inclined to think that it was originally purchased by a local jurusdiction versus the State. Regardless, that's a really nice find. What are your plans for the car?
